Excerpts from Manuel Kaufmann's message of 2012-03-15 15:08:51 +0100:

> After compiling sugar with jhbuild in Fedora 16, I'm tryin to run the
> emulator but I'm getting this error:
> 
> "Failed to start server. Please check output above for any message"

Well, like it says, the actual error message is elsewhere, so we can't
help you much without further information. Can you post the full
output, please?

Please make sure to update sugar-jhbuild and install anything
"./sugar-jhbuild depscheck" mentions (except for gnome-python2-evince
- I still need to fix the Read dependencies) before trying again.

If there's no error message (or just something unhelpful), please try
running the following command directly:

Xephyr :100 -ac -title 'Sugar in a window' -screen 800x600 -noreset

I expect it to fail, but once you tried that you can use the Fedora
support channels to get help; there's nothing Sugar-specific about it
then.


Your now-working Debian Wheezy setup should be better than a Fedora 16
one (at least Fedora 17 seems to be required for everything to work),
though. ;)
